Noise in general helps in several area in my life:

  - Working out, pump up music for motivation. 
  - Cleaning or chores, enjoyable music or podcasts for motivation or filling space.
  - Light, shallow work, lo-fi to upbeat chill without vocals for motivation and masking environmental noise.
  - Deep, concentrated work, white or pink noise for masking environmental noise. Depending on the task, I will opt for silence.
To further explain white or pink noise use benefits in my case, they provide subtle stimulation and are minor distractions if I concentrate on them. However, the utility gained from masking environmental noise exceeds the utility loss in the rare moments that I shift focus to the white or pink noise, so I think it's a net positive for me.
